#0de64d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0de64d is composed of 5.1% red, 90.2%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 66.5%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 137.7 degrees, a saturation of 89.3% and a lightness of 47.6%. #0de64d color hex could be obtained by blending #1aff9a with #00cd00. Closest websafe color is: #00ff66.

#0de64d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0de64d has RGB values of R:13, G:230,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0, Y:0.67,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 910925.

Shades and Tints of #0de64d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000702 is the darkest color, while #f4fef7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#0de64d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#747f77 is the less saturated color, while #04ef49 is the most saturated one.
